About
Play your way through the different maps generated with every playthrough, constantly on the move away from the calamity of light, the Shine Raid, to your left and on your final battle with the Fallen Angel Alma. There's no turning back, once this thrilling one-way adventure begins!

Mystery Chronicle: One Way Heroics — Session FAQ
- How long does a session of Mystery Chronicle: One Way Heroics take?
- The minimum meaningful session for Mystery Chronicle: One Way Heroics is approximately 20 minutes. This is the shortest play window where you can make real progress or have a satisfying experience, based on community data.
- Can you pause Mystery Chronicle: One Way Heroics?
- Mystery Chronicle: One Way Heroics uses save points or manual saves. You'll need to reach a checkpoint before exiting to avoid losing progress — factor this into your session planning.
- Does Mystery Chronicle: One Way Heroics pressure you to keep playing?
- Mystery Chronicle: One Way Heroics has low FOMO. There may be some narrative momentum, but the game doesn't pressure you to keep playing. Natural stopping points are common.
- What is Mystery Chronicle: One Way Heroics's Session Respect Score?
- Mystery Chronicle: One Way Heroics has a Session Respect Score of 6.2/10. This score combines minimum session length, pausability, FOMO level, and pickup friendliness into a single metric for how well the game fits busy schedules.
